Psychodynamic Child Therapist/Psychotherapist   

Bridge in Schools Programme   

We have a number of vacancies for September 2024 in our partnership schools.  These are potentially in primary, secondary and SEN settings.

 These opportunities are for suitably qualified and experienced therapists to join a lively, experienced team, and to deliver psychodynamic psychotherapy interventions in schools in Bristol to a wide range of children and families. Posts are usually for one day per week in school (can be more) and  also include three hours of paid time for supervision, team meetings and continuing professional development on a Wednesday morning.   

The Bridge Foundation is a Bristol based charity, which has been delivering a range of clinical and training services relating to the needs of children, young people, families, and adults for over almost 40 years. Our approach is psychodynamic and psychoanalytic, although we have staff from a variety of professional backgrounds. Working for us is a unique opportunity to be a part of an organisation that prioritises this way of working, and as such we offer regular CPD to enhance psychodynamic and psychoanalytic skills, and to apply this way of thinking to our practice and work settings.  Regular supervision, both individual and group, is a keystone of the offer from the Bridge.    

 Supervisors are experienced Child Psychotherapists and Psychodynamic Counsellors and Psychotherapists, meaning that the psychodynamic focus of the work is at the forefront of our thinking. CPD is offered within the Bridge in Schools team to develop schools-based practice and within the whole organisation to develop psychoanalytic/psychodynamic skills and thinking. We hold regular ‘thinking space’ forums to focus on thinking about issues of race, diversity and difference through a psychodynamic lens. The amount of supervision, support and skills development on offer at the Bridge Foundation helps us maintain a high level of staff retention and provides a secure base from which to deliver the challenging work of counselling and psychotherapy.   

 Applicants need to demonstrate experience of bringing psychodynamic thinking to working with children with special needs and their families. They will be qualified as a UKCP/ BCP/BACP/HCP accredited psychodynamic child counsellor, or a qualified child psychotherapist accredited with the ACP. Child psychotherapists experienced in schools work and close to completing their training may be considered.  A professional education, mental health or social work background, a good understanding of child development, and an experience of personal analysis would be highly relevant.
